Remote CCTV for UK wide locations.

Recommended Posts

Hi,

 

I am looking for some advice on the above topic.

 

I am looking to install 2-3 camera in 5-10 different locations throughout the UK.

 

All the locations have ADSL installed in them

I am looking to be able to view these from anywhere in the world on one system (over the web)

Some camera will be located inside but most will be external.

 

Can anyone point me towards such a system and suggest any camera to use?

 

Thanks in advance for any responses.

a simple way would be to put a 4 channel dvr in each location and then use a CM software to monitor all dvrs together. take a look at the eb3004 avermedia with there cm300 software.

Thanks I will have a look at these. Is there a unit that does more than 4 cameras. Possibly up to 10 that is compatible with cm300 software?

 

 

yes you can go 4-8-16-32 also going hybrid will also let you just install ip cameras at 1 location and the recorder somewere else. so if you have 10 locations you dont need 10 recorders

Hi,

 

the purpose of this CCTV setup is to allow cameras to be installed in a few different locations around the country which can be viewed remotely by a security guard working in a different site to reduce the need to have security in every site.

 

Initially I am looking to setup up to 10 camera's (internal and external) in the main location where the security is located and also install 4 cameras in a remote location which will allow all camera to be viewed on one system in the main location. Preferably with some sort of monitor for movement in the remote location displaying in the main location.

 

I do currently have camera and recording systems in each location but these are very old and stand alone. I may (and would) hope to be able to reuse the camera in place and replace some (but not all) the camera. If this works successfully then it will be a phased roll out to another 5 or more site.

 

thanks for your response.

 

 

well cm software is the way for you to go. and you can also use your existing cameras. how it works is you change your existing dvrs that you have and in locations were you have nothing you install ip cameras. that way your security can call all cameras back to one location. you can also set your location cameras with alarm functions to alert your security of anything happening.
